The Back Of House Team Member typically handles a variety of support tasks in the kitchen, such as cleaning, prep work, and assisting cooks, while the Line Cook focuses on preparing specific dishes at designated stations. Both roles are essential in restaurant operations, but they differ in responsibilities and skill requirements.
